The Chargers fell from second overall at the end of the first round, which coach John Randle said made for a disappointing day, but he\u2019s happy with how his players reacted to the turn of events. \u201cThe guys tried their best and they conducted themselves like gentlemen,\u201d he said in a press release. \u201cI\u2019m proud of them.\u201d<\/p>\n<p><strong>Royals prospect going to 2012 winter youth Olympics<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Joe Hicketts, the 15-year-old first-ever draft pick of the Victoria Royals WHL hockey club, has been selected to represent Canada at the 2012 Winter Youth Olympic Games. The games will be held in Innsbruck, Austria from January 13\u201322. The 2012 Winter Youth Olympic Games are the first of its kind.
